    Judging by parish records entries they were the only Chapmans in Milton Bryan, and as Joseph was of the right age and of Milton Bryan, and as he seemed to disappear, I think it's very probable that the husband of Elizabeth and the one who was transported are one and same person.

    You may find something in the Overseers accounts which would add to the evidence eg relief paid to Elizabeth as her husband was transported

    Not proof, but most likely he was ..

    Joseph chr 24/08/1817 Milton Bryant, was son of Joseph & Elizabeth Chapman. Joseph Chapman married Elizabeth Wikam/Wipham/Whipham at Tilsworth on 29/09/1814. There is also a baptism of Mary 23/07/1815.

    Joseph (senior) was age 24 when got sent abroad in 1817 = born 1793
    Elizabeth buried in 1824 (5 months after her children) at age 31 = born 1793

    There is a Joseph chr 16/09//1792 at Tilsworth, parents William & Elizabeth Chapman. Could not find a baptism for Elizabeth on IGI.

    Noted that Joseph (junior) & wife Mary & children are living in Tilsworth on 1841 & 1851 censuses.

    As well as looking for info at Milton Bryant you should try at Tilworth, She may have gone back to her home village after husband went away.
